MySQL中str_to_date函數是一個非常實用的函數,它可以將字符串轉換成日期格式。在本文中,我們將詳細介紹如何使用str_to_date函數,以及它的一些常見用法。
一、str_to_date函數的基本語法
str_to_date函數的基本語法如下:
at表示字符串的日期格式。
二、str_to_date函數的常見用法
1. 將字符串轉換為日期格式
在MySQL中,str_to_date函數最常見的用途就是將字符串轉換為日期格式。我們可以使用以下代碼將字符串“2022-01-01”轉換為日期格式:
-%d');
-%d'表示日期格式為年-月-日。
2. 將字符串轉換為時間格式
除了將字符串轉換為日期格式,str_to_date函數還可以將字符串轉換為時間格式。我們可以使用以下代碼將字符串“12:30:00”轉換為時間格式:
SELECT str_to_date('12:30:00','%H:%i:%s');
其中,'%H:%i:%s'表示時間格式為時:分:秒。
3. 將字符串轉換為日期時間格式
除了將字符串轉換為日期格式和時間格式,str_to_date函數還可以將字符串轉換為日期時間格式。我們可以使用以下代碼將字符串“2022-01-01 12:30:00”轉換為日期時間格式:
-%d %H:%i:%s');
-%d %H:%i:%s'表示日期時間格式為年-月-日 時:分:秒。
str_to_date函數是MySQL中非常實用的函數,它可以將字符串轉換為日期、時間、日期時間等格式。在使用該函數時,需要注意字符串的日期格式,以及使用正確的日期格式符號。通過本文的介紹,相信大家已經掌握了str_to_date函數的使用方法,希望對大家有所幫助。